Key inclusion & exclusion criteria

PROTOCOL ENTRY CRITERIA:

--Disease Characteristics--

- Diagnosis of liver disease with chronic cholestasis Nonsyndromic intrahepatic
cholestasis Alagille's syndrome Extrahepatic biliary atresia

- Direct bilirubin greater than 2 mg/dL OR Bile acids greater than 20 micromoles/L

- No hepatic decompensation defined as one or more of the following: Ascites Peripheral
edema PT at least 4 seconds longer than control Albumin less than 3 g/dL

--Patient Characteristics--

- Renal: No significant renal disease

- Cardiovascular: No significant cardiovascular disease

- Pulmonary: No significant pulmonary disease



Age minimum: 3 Years
Age maximum: 18 Years
Gender: Both
